Kinds Of Door Handles to Consider
When picking door handles for renovation, understanding the various types available can assist limit your choices. Here are some popular options:
1. Lever Handles
- Description: Lever handles are widely popular for both interior and exterior doors due to their ease of usage.
- Styles: Available in modern, conventional, and even minimalist designs.
2. Knob Handles
- Description: The traditional round or oval-shaped knobs are a staple in numerous homes.
- Styles: Various surfaces and products are available, including metal, wood, and ceramic.
3. Mortise Handles
- Description: Used mostly on exterior doors, these require special installation and normally consist of a lock mechanism.
- Styles: Often more ornate, suitable for conventional settings.
4. Pull Handles
- Description: These are typically utilized on sliding doors, kitchen doors, or cabinets.
- Designs: Can be minimalist or statement pieces, depending upon the material and style.

Steps to Renovate Door Handles
Starting a door handle renovation can be an amazing DIY job.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Evaluate Your Current Handles
- Take a look at the condition of existing handles.
- Determine if you wish to change them entirely or simply upgrade the surfaces.
Step 2: Choose Your Design Style
- Research study various styles to find what fits your home's aesthetic.
- Think about coordinating finishes (e.g., brushed nickel, oil-rubbed bronze) with other components in your house.
Step 3: Measure Your Existing Hardware
- Precisely measure the size and spacing of screws to guarantee brand-new handles fit properly.
- Remember of any specialized fittings your present handles might use.
Step 4: Purchase New Hardware
- Visit hardware shops or browse online merchants to compare designs and costs.
- Try to find brand names known for resilience and style.
Step 5: Gather Necessary Tools
Before you begin installation, ensure you have:
- Screwdrivers (Phillips and flathead)
- Measuring tape
- Level (if needed)
- Safety goggles (for extra security)
Step 6: Remove Old Door Handles
- Carefully loosen the existing handles from the door.
- Keep the screws as you might require them for the new handles.
Action 7: Install New Door Handles
- Follow the manufacturer's directions to set up the new handles.
- Guarantee they are secured firmly and level.
Step 8: Final Touches
- Check the handles for functionality.
- Clean any finger prints or smudges from installation.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How frequently should I change door handles?
It's recommended to examine door handles every few years, searching for wear and tear. In addition, consider changing them when redesigning or updating your home design.
2. Can I blend various styles of door handles in my home?
Yes, mixing styles can produce a diverse appearance. However, go for an unified color palette or theme to preserve a cohesive look.
3. What is the very best material for door handles?
The very best product often depends on place and usage. Stainless-steel is durable and resistant to rust, while bronze provides a more timeless appearance. Select based upon both functionality and design preference.
4. How can I guarantee my new handles are protected?
Guarantee they are installed according to the manufacturer's guide and check for any loose screws after a couple of days of usage.
5. Can I set up door handles myself?
Yes! Numerous door handles are designed for easy installation and can be done by yourself with the right tools and guidelines.
